Commodities Business Analyst London Hybrid - 4 days on site £700 inside IR35 We are working with a leading financial services organisation seeking an experienced Commodities Business Analyst to join a front office aligned technology team. This is a hands on role acting as the bridge between trading, sales and structuring teams and IT delivery. Role Overview You will sit close to the front office, translating business requirements into high quality technical deliverables. The role covers the full delivery lifecycle, from requirements gathering through to testing, release and ongoing support, within an Agile environment. What You Will Be Working On • Acting as the primary interface between front office users and development teams • Gathering, analysing and documenting business requirements • Driving solution design and promoting scalable, long term technical solutions • Managing testing, business sign off and production releases • Supporting and enhancing core commodities systems including pricing, market data, risk and reporting tools • Working across the full proximity development lifecycle including analysis, delivery and support • Collaborating with global stakeholders across Front Office, Risk, Quants and IT Must Have Skills and Experience • Extensive/ senior level experience as a Business Analyst with commodities domain knowledge • Good understanding of pricing / risk within commodities • Open to multiple commodity classes such as Energy, Base Metals or Precious Metals • Strong Agile delivery experience • Sufficient technical knowledge to work closely with developers.
